Advertisement

基于STM32的RGB灯蓝牙键盘电路图、PCB及物料清单

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
本项目介绍了一种基于STM32微控制器设计的RGB灯蓝牙键盘,提供了详细的电路图、PCB布局以及物料清单,适用于电子爱好者和工程师参考。 STM32是STMicroelectronics(意法半导体)公司开发的微控制器系列,基于ARM Cortex-M内核,在各种嵌入式系统设计中有广泛应用,包括我们的RGB灯蓝牙键盘项目。在这个项目中,主控芯片为STM32C8T6,它具备低功耗、高性能及丰富的外设接口特性,非常适合这种需要电池供电且需处理复杂控制任务的设备。 RGB灯通常用于提供多彩照明效果;WS2812是一种常见的数字LED控制器,集成了RGB LED驱动和数据接收功能。每个WS2812都可以独立调节红绿蓝三色亮度,并通过单线数据接口实现串行通信,从而操控整个灯带的颜色与亮度变化。在蓝牙键盘上使用RGB灯可以增强视觉效果,使产品更具吸引力。 蓝牙键盘利用无线技术连接至电脑、手机和平板等设备,提供便捷的输入方式;蓝牙4.0及以上版本具备低功耗特性,在电池供电设备中尤为节能。STM32C8T6可通过内置Bluetooth Low Energy (BLE)堆栈或外部模块实现蓝牙功能。 原理图是电路设计的核心部分,详细描绘了各个元件间的连接关系及电源、信号和控制路径;在本项目中,它展示了STM32C8T6如何与WS2812、蓝牙模块、锂电池充放电管理单元及其他必要组件(如按键、USB接口等)相互关联。通过分析原理图可以了解各部件的工作机制及其交互方式。 PCB设计则将电路原理转化为实际物理布局,设计师需考虑电气性能、尺寸限制及散热等因素,确保所有元件合理安装在板上,并通过导电路径实现通信;本项目中可能需要特别关注信号的抗干扰能力,因为无线通讯和RGB灯快速变化都可能导致电磁干扰。 BOM(物料清单)是项目所需硬件组件列表,包含每个部件型号、数量及供应商信息,在采购与生产阶段至关重要,确保所有元件正确装配至产品上。 此项目涉及微控制器编程、无线通信、电源管理以及LED控制等多个IT领域知识点。通过深入研究相关资料,开发者可学习如何利用STM32实现蓝牙键盘功能,并掌握RGB灯的操控技术;同时还能了解设计和优化包含电池管理在内的便携式电子设备的方法。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• STM32RGBPCB
    优质
    本项目介绍了一种基于STM32微控制器设计的RGB灯蓝牙键盘,提供了详细的电路图、PCB布局以及物料清单,适用于电子爱好者和工程师参考。 STM32是STMicroelectronics(意法半导体)公司开发的微控制器系列,基于ARM Cortex-M内核,在各种嵌入式系统设计中有广泛应用,包括我们的RGB灯蓝牙键盘项目。在这个项目中,主控芯片为STM32C8T6,它具备低功耗、高性能及丰富的外设接口特性,非常适合这种需要电池供电且需处理复杂控制任务的设备。 RGB灯通常用于提供多彩照明效果;WS2812是一种常见的数字LED控制器,集成了RGB LED驱动和数据接收功能。每个WS2812都可以独立调节红绿蓝三色亮度,并通过单线数据接口实现串行通信,从而操控整个灯带的颜色与亮度变化。在蓝牙键盘上使用RGB灯可以增强视觉效果,使产品更具吸引力。 蓝牙键盘利用无线技术连接至电脑、手机和平板等设备,提供便捷的输入方式;蓝牙4.0及以上版本具备低功耗特性,在电池供电设备中尤为节能。STM32C8T6可通过内置Bluetooth Low Energy (BLE)堆栈或外部模块实现蓝牙功能。 原理图是电路设计的核心部分,详细描绘了各个元件间的连接关系及电源、信号和控制路径;在本项目中,它展示了STM32C8T6如何与WS2812、蓝牙模块、锂电池充放电管理单元及其他必要组件(如按键、USB接口等)相互关联。通过分析原理图可以了解各部件的工作机制及其交互方式。 PCB设计则将电路原理转化为实际物理布局,设计师需考虑电气性能、尺寸限制及散热等因素,确保所有元件合理安装在板上,并通过导电路径实现通信;本项目中可能需要特别关注信号的抗干扰能力,因为无线通讯和RGB灯快速变化都可能导致电磁干扰。 BOM(物料清单)是项目所需硬件组件列表,包含每个部件型号、数量及供应商信息,在采购与生产阶段至关重要,确保所有元件正确装配至产品上。 此项目涉及微控制器编程、无线通信、电源管理以及LED控制等多个IT领域知识点。通过深入研究相关资料,开发者可学习如何利用STM32实现蓝牙键盘功能,并掌握RGB灯的操控技术;同时还能了解设计和优化包含电池管理在内的便携式电子设备的方法。
  • STM32操控RGB.zip
    优质
    本项目为一个基于STM32微控制器和蓝牙技术控制RGB LED灯的作品。用户可以通过手机APP或其他蓝牙设备发送指令来改变LED灯的颜色和亮度。 使用STM32F103和HC-06通过数据帧方式发送数据。
  • 平衡车PCB.rar
    优质
    本资源包含平衡车的核心部件——PCB电路图以及详细的物料清单。适合电子制作爱好者和技术开发人员参考学习。下载后可直接用于硬件设计与调试。 平衡车是一种电力驱动且具备自我平衡能力的个人运输工具。其工作原理主要基于飞机的平衡机制,也被称为体感车或思维车。这种设备在多个领域都有广泛应用,包括个人交通、工作巡逻、室内场馆管理、高尔夫球赛事服务、警察巡逻、会展安保以及大型活动工作人员通勤等,并且还适用于旅游娱乐和汽车搭载等多种场景。
  • 矩阵PCB
    优质
    本资源提供详细的矩阵键盘电路设计图纸和PCB布局文件,适用于各类电子项目开发与学习。 矩阵键盘的原理图和PCB设计包含了详细的电路布局与连接方式,用于实现按键输入功能。这种设计方案能够有效地减少所需引脚的数量,并简化硬件结构。通过将多个按键组织成行和列的形式,可以使用较少数量的I/O端口来检测大量按键的状态变化。 当矩阵键盘中的某个键被按下时,对应的行列线会产生电平变化,进而触发中断或由微控制器定期扫描以识别具体是哪个按键发生了动作。为了提高系统的响应速度与准确性,在实际应用中往往还会加入去抖动处理等措施确保信号稳定可靠。
  • 无线充PCBBOM.zip
    优质
    本资源包包含一款无线充电电动牙刷的完整电路设计文档,包括详细的电路图、PCB布局文件以及物料清单(BOM),适用于相关产品的研发与制造。 此无线充电电动牙刷的原理图和BOM清单基于瑞萨R7F0C807 微控制器。提供的资料包含PCB文件和SCH原理图文件,但没有进行详细介绍。
  • HP 3458A
    优质
    《HP 3458A电路图和物料清单》为电子爱好者及工程师提供详尽的硬件参考,包括全面的电路布局与组件列表,是深入研究经典测试设备不可或缺的资源。 Component-Level Information Packet for HP 3458A Digital Multimeter, including schematic diagrams, bill of materials, and board layouts.
  • STM32F103C8T6 WS2812 RGB板带
    优质
    本产品是一款基于STM32F103C8T6微控制器和WS2812 RGB灯条的智能控制板,支持蓝牙无线连接,可实现灯光颜色、亮度等参数的远程调节与个性化设置。 PA.7连接WS2812的DIN引脚,蓝牙模块的TXRX接口与单片机串口2(即PA.2, PA.3)相连,可以独立控制驱动超过100枚串联的WS2812灯珠,并且已经编写了一些基础的灯光效果代码可供参考。
  • 值表
    优质
    《蓝牙键盘键值表》是一份详细的参考文档,列出各种蓝牙键盘按键对应的编码值。它帮助开发者和用户理解与实现键盘输入数据处理,适用于多种操作系统环境下的软件开发与调试工作。 完整的蓝牙键值表收录了所有蓝牙按键的键值,并包括joystick模式状态。
  • RGB-Lamp-Control: 适用RGB LEDAndroid控制应用
    优质
    RGB-Lamp-Control是一款专为RGB LED灯设计的Android应用,通过蓝牙技术实现便捷的灯光颜色和效果调节。用户可以轻松定制个人喜好的照明氛围。 RGB灯控制器用于控制RGB LED灯的Android蓝牙设备。
  • 51片机(LCD1602)系统——包含Proteus仿真、原理、流程源代码
    优质
    本项目设计了一套基于51单片机的电话键盘控制系统,通过LCD1602显示信息,并提供了Proteus仿真文件、电路原理图、程序流程图和完整源代码。 基于51单片机的电话键盘(LCD1602)设计用于模拟电话拨号显示装置,即在按下某个键后将所输入的号码通过LCD显示屏进行实时展示。该设备配备有包括数字键0至9在内的总共十二个按键,并且还设有“*”键来实现删除功能——它可以撤销最近一次输入的一个字符;而“#”键则用于清除屏幕上的所有已显示内容,重新开始新的拨号操作。每当用户按下任一键时,系统会发出声音提示以确认该动作已被执行。 为了确保电话号码的准确性以及易于后续调试和维护的目的,在整个设计过程中还需绘制出相应的原理图、流程图,并列出所需物料清单等技术文档;同时通过Proteus软件进行电路仿真测试。此外,代码部分将采用C语言编写并完成相关功能实现工作,即在实际硬件环境下验证程序的正确性和可靠性。 本项目的主要任务是开发一个能够准确显示八位数字电话号码的系统,并确保每一步操作都有声音反馈机制以增强用户体验感与交互性。